The best option would be to create separate user account on the computer that you separately use to sync with. This keeps contact and calendar data from being merged together. You can however still sync or share media with each user by following the steps in the second article below.
Do you share your computer with someone who has different tastes in music and media? You can create separate user accounts for each person who uses the computer. You can maintain separate, personalized iTunes libraries and customize each devices' sync settings accordingly.
Learn how to set up other user accounts.
Look in your computer's Help documentation to learn how to set up other user accounts. To find this information:
- Click the Start Menu and click Help or Help and Support.
- Enter "new user" in the Search field.
- Press Return.
If you create multiple user accounts on one computer but want the same media to be available in iTunes for all users, you can share music between different accounts on a single computer.
